As we find ourselves in the midst of 2025, the gaming world continues to evolve at a rapid pace with digital innovation at the forefront. One of the most notable trends is the shift towards 'cashfree' gaming experiences, with digital currency becoming a staple in online platforms. This transition is not just a trend; it is a fundamental transformation that is reshaping how gamers interact, transact, and engage with the virtual world.

At the heart of this transformation is the widespread adoption of digital currencies. Cryptocurrencies and blockchain technology have become integral to numerous gaming platforms, offering seamless, secure, and transparent transactions. This movement towards a cashless society is mirrored by the real world, where digital payments have become more prevalent across various sectors.

Online gaming websites, particularly those targeting a global audience, have been quick to adapt. Platforms like Steam and Epic Games Store, along with countless independent websites, now integrate cryptocurrency options alongside traditional payment methods. This not only caters to a tech-savvy audience but also enhances security, reducing the risk of fraud and enhancing privacy for users.

The economic dynamics within these virtual environments are changing too. Virtual items and services, once transacted using conventional currencies, are increasingly priced in digital tokens. The benefits of this system include lower transaction fees, faster processing times, and fewer geographical barriers, enabling gamers from all around the world to participate in the global gaming economy regardless of their local financial infrastructure.

Industry experts are also observing a growth in play-to-earn models, driven by blockchain technology. Gamers are rewarded with cryptocurrencies for their achievements, creating a parallel economy within the games. This blurs the line between gaming for entertainment and gaming as an economic activity, potentially providing significant income streams for skilled players.

However, this shift is not without its challenges. Concerns about the volatility of cryptocurrencies, security breaches, and the environmental impact of blockchain operations are hot topics within the industry. Nevertheless, stakeholders believe these challenges can be mitigated with ongoing technological advancements and regulatory oversight.

In conclusion, the gaming industry in 2025 is firmly on the path to a cashless future. For players and developers alike, the adoption of digital currencies introduces exciting possibilities, fostering an interconnected virtual ecosystem where the boundaries of gaming and economy continue to expand.
